Second Life in a web browser: beta launches

November 16, 2010 by Metaverse Journal Editor Leave a Comment

With minimal fanfare, Linden Lab have launched a beta of their 'Second Life in a browser' offering AKA Project Skylight. Found here, you can sign-up and check it out in a session lasting up to an hour. Second Life in a browser on the near horizon

October 28, 2010 by Metaverse Journal Editor Leave a Comment

"Project Skylight" is its name apparently, and it's the project that will hopefully deliver Second Life in a web browser. Tateru Nino got a confirmation from Linden Lab that testing will be occurring, so hopefully we'll see some concrete examples in the short-term.
